Mar 19, 2024

On this episode, Florence Moreau of TeXtreme joins me to discuss their new TeXtreme 360°. It belongs to a new class of composite materials called tape-based Discontinuous Fiber Composites (DFCs), combining in-plane isotropy, high strength and stiffness, and enhanced manufacturability. 

This new class of composite materials is an alternative to traditional metal alloys and continuous fiber composites, unlocking new possibilities across a wide range of applications.

Textreme has established itself as the market leader in spread tow thin-ply carbon reinforcements. Introduced to the market in 2005,  it was quickly recognized in high-performance sports applications where customers valued its low weight and high performance.
